Probably a staged rollout, like it always is with Google. I got it a few days ago, quite a while after I installed the actual system update. It will notify you with a ‘tutorial bubble’ inside your notification shade when it becomes available.

So far, the summaries are pretty hit-and-miss in when they trigger. I have a very active Telegram group I would expect it to summarise, but I have only seen it do so like twice so far – most of the time, it just shows the latest messages, like normal.

The content is also questionable. It basically just rephrases the latest one or two messages instead of telling you about what the larger conversation has been about. Like, right now, I can see a summary, ‘Johnny needs to remove the folder before restarting the script,’ – what folder? What script?

Hungarian lead translator for DRG here.

You can report language issues (be it the original English version or any localisation) in one of two places:

  • The easier method is through Discord. On the official DRG Discord server, just make a thread describing the issue in the #report-typos-only-typos-nothing-but-typos-or-typos-and-typos-plus-typos-uniquely-typos-no-more-space forum channel.
  • The other way is through Crowdin, the platform where the game is translated. You can look for the piece of text which has issues, then in the comments section, describe the problem. Make sure to tag it as a ‘Mistake in the source string’ if it's a problem with the English version.

For the record, this specific problem has already been reported.
